When it's time to move, you'll need to print out in duplicate form 5320.20. If you are moving to another state or traveling to another state you have to have that approved.
FYI, the form has only 3 entries so if you have more NFA items you'll need to print out more and duplicate it also. When I sent mine off for permanent change of address it took a little over 2 months to get back the approved copy.

im done with the ASR. The module consistently shoots itself loose, the locking ring consistently fricks up, and the can teeth/threads lock up with carbon buildup after any extended shooting. I'm sending SiCo the module to get a replacement. Really wanting to go Keymo though
i shot 800 rounds in a day for a class and I literally had to get a strap wrench to break it off. that's unacceptable.
